The acetalization of glycerol with butanal was carried out in the presence of silicotungstic acid (HSiW) immobilized in silica, by sol-gel technique, at 70ºC. The products of glycerol acetalization with butanal were (Z + E)-(2-propyl-1,3-dioxolan-4-yl) methanol and (Z + E)-2-propyl-1,3-dioxan-5-ol. Catalysts with different amount of HSiW were prepared. The glycerol is a by-product in the biodiesel production. For every 9 kg of biodiesel produced, about 1 kg of a crude glycerol is formed. Due to the increase of biodiesel production, an increase of glycerol production has been observed. METHOXYLATION OF LIMONENE OVER SULFONATED STARCH

Castanheiro, J; Cruz, J

Methoxylation of limonene was carried out in the presence of sulfonated starch. The main product of methoxylation of limonene is alpha-terpinyl methyl ether. Catalysts with different amounts of sulfonic acid groups were prepared. The catalytic activity increased with the amount of sulfonic acid groups in starch. Henriques, P; Castanheiro, J

Acetalization of glycerol with pentanal was carried out in the presence of SBA-15 with sulfonic acid groups. Materials with different amounts of sulfonic acid groups were prepared. It was observed that the catalytic activity increases with the amount of sulfonic acid groups on SBA-15 until a maximum. With high amount of sulfonic groups, a decrease of activity is observed.
